单片机c51中用关键字 来改变寄存器组_单片机c51

交换机 2024-05-02 生活 35

扫一扫用手机浏览

文章目录 [+]

C51单片机和C52单片机有什么区别?

种类不同:51系列单片机是指51内核,stc89c5X基本都是51内核的种类。大小不同:最后一个数字表示E2prom的大小,E2prom=X*4K,c51就是4K,c52就是8k。

单片机c51中用关键字 来改变寄存器组_单片机c51

有以下区别:两者都是直流供电电压单片机,STC89C51电压为5V-5V,STC89LE52的电压为0V-8V;STC89c51/52的存储器不一样,51有4K,52有8K;内部FLASH变大:AT89C51 有 4K 字节的内部 FLASH PERAM,而。

C51和C52同属于51系列单片机,它们的内核都是MCS51,单片机的封装也相同,所不同的地方有以下几点:第一,ROM容量不同,c51是4k flash,c52是8k flash。第二,RAM容量不同,c51是128个字节,c52为256个字节。

C51及C52单片机在内核结构上完全一样,两者的主要差别在RAM和ROM上,C51是128byte RAM,4K ROM,C52是256Byte,8K ROM。

c51语言可用于52单片机吗?

完全可以,不用修改程序,C52只是多了一个定时器和多了一点存储空间,如果你程序在C51上能运行,那在C52上当然也能运行。

C52比80C51多一个内部定时器T2。另外,52的容量比51的大。除此,两者的I/O口引脚相同,各寄存器的定义与地址相同。因此,C51的程序可直接用到C52上,但C52的程序不一定能用到C51上。

Keil C51是美国Keil Software公司出品的51系列兼容单片机C语言软件开发系统。

reg5h是c51(用于单片机开发的一种c语言)的头文件。类似于头文件AT89X5h。

应该是可以互用的,不过对于仿真用51,还是52,对设计没有太大影响。由于不知道你具体的不正常是指什么,所以,我提2种常见的可能。

C51语言有哪些特点,作为单片机设计语言,它与汇编语言相比有什么不同,优...

C51可以用标准C语言(以及一定的扩展)来书写源程序,所以具有更好的通用性、可读性和可维护性。缺点是有时候无法精准地进行细微操作,执行效率也会为了“通用性”而做出一定(某些情况下,巨大)的牺牲。

C51属于间接面向机器的中级语言,同样具有独特的特点,生成的机器代码相对简洁、占ROM空间稍大、执行效率可以接受,适用于一些对时序要求不是特别精确的场合,如各种控制程序、显示程序、通信程序、测量程序等等。

区别:(1)记忆角度对于初学者而言,汇编要去记忆一些单片机的专有指令系统命令,比如:MOV 、CPL、 MOVX等等。C51可以理解成用C语言来设计51系列单片机程序,只要用通用的C语言程序即可以完成。

单片机C51语言提供了完备的数据类型、运算符及函数供使用。C51语言是一种结构化程序设计语言,可以使用一对花括号“{}”将一系列语句组合成一个复合语句,程序结构清晰明了。

单片机种类繁多,如何选择适合自己的芯片?

1、对新手的建议:\x0d\x0a 首先根据自己学的什么样单片机就选什么类型的单片机,熟悉什么类型的单片机就选什么类型的单片机。因为单片机不仅要设计电路,还要设计控制软件。选自己熟悉的单片机上手最快,也最容易获得成功。

2、技术性:要从单片机的技术指标角度,对单片机芯片进行选择,以保证单片机应用系统在一定的技术指标下可靠运行。

3、MSP430以低功耗著称,适合做一些测量仪表之类的事。凌阳单片机自带语音用能,很多个高级玩具中都有他的身影。ARM系列一般用在作嵌入式上面,用来做手机的主控芯片,如果把它当做普通的单片机来用的话,优势并不明显。

4、只要掌握和运用单片机正确选型的原则,就可以选择出最能适用于应用系统的单片机,保证单片要应用系统有最高的可靠性,最优的性能价格比,最长的使用寿命和最好的升级换代可能。

5、如果想要完成简单的程序设计可以考虑使用价格比较低内存较小的8051型单片机,使用Kill进行程序编写通信波特率一般为9600,但其时钟控制不是很好;如果需要更好的,可以是ARM及以上的芯片。

51单片机和52单片机区别

1、单片机和52单片机区别:种类不同:51系列单片机是指51内核,stc89c5X基本都是51内核的种类。大小不同:最后一个数字表示E2prom的大小,E2prom=X*4K,c51就是4K,c52就是8k。

2、有以下区别:两者都是直流供电电压单片机,STC89C51电压为5V-5V,STC89LE52的电压为0V-8V;STC89c51/52的存储器不一样,51有4K,52有8K;内部FLASH变大:AT89C51 有 4K 字节的内部 FLASH PERAM,而。

3、C51单片机和C52单片机的主要区别在于它们内部EEPROM的大小和片上***。 EEPROM大小:C51的EEPROM大小为4K,而C52的EEPROM大小为8K。

4、单片机和52单片机的区别还是比较多的,其中51单片机是没有定时器的,而52单片机是有定时器的,对于这一点还是需要了解的。

标签:

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.ishengkuan.com/15974.html

相关文章